Management Science in Michigan

Management Science Schools in Michigan

In 2022-2023, 1,035 students earned their Management Science degrees in MI.

As a degree choice, Management Science is the 32nd most popular major in the state.

Education Levels of Management Science Majors in Michigan

Management Science majors in the state tend to have the following degree levels:

Education Level Number of Grads
Master’s Degree 698
Bachelor’s Degree 274
Post-Master’s Certificate 56
Postbaccalaureate Certificate 56
Doctor’s Degree (Research / Scholarship) 6
Doctor’s Degree (Professional Practice) 6
Doctor’s Degree (Other) 6
Associate Degree 1

Jobs for Management Science Grads in Michigan

There are 67,500 people in the state and 2,893,390 people in the nation working in management science jobs.

undefined

Wages for Management Science Jobs in Michigan

In this state, management science grads earn an average of $88,820. Nationwide, they make an average of $92,600.
